Transaction 764b96cbda0117e7a32b430ad85b93b331200b0f9562410ddeb70091130e6e98

1 Input
2 Outputs
  • 764b96cbda0117e7a32b430ad85b93b331200b0f9562410ddeb70091130e6e98:0
  • value  389426
    address  16XCSrpBGZnjSwdtP8SpMmHswL9DsWvV9p
  • 764b96cbda0117e7a32b430ad85b93b331200b0f9562410ddeb70091130e6e98:1
  • value  9621197
    address  3JFATVZSpL9EhgM2PEeC6tzpdZfoQ451kx